How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Southwest Village Camelvista?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Southwest Village Camelvista Studio Apartments | $1,482 | $825 | $2,000 |
| Southwest Village Camelvista 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,758 | $920 | $10,000+ |
| Southwest Village Camelvista 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,338 | $1,200 | $10,000+ |
| Southwest Village Camelvista 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,523 | $1,630 | $10,000+ |
| Southwest Village Camelvista 4 Bedroom Apartments | $5,741 | $4,088 | $9,896 |
